Can okra be grown in Mississippi Delta and if so when is the best time to plant?

0

Okra (gumbo) can be grown in Mississippi Delta. The seeds should be placed outdoors around May 10. Seed indoors in pots or other suitable containers around April 20 and transplant in the garden around May 20. Okra needs plenty of space and a long, warm season for good production. Space plants about 12 to 15 inches apart in rows 3 feet apart.
